that guy on ebay that sells procomp heads swears by em, claims he has em on his blown 500in wedge.... i've heard the main problems with em is the ports have alot of casting flash in em, and the bolt holes for the exhaust don't have helicoils, so i was thinking about getting a set of cnc ported versions, that would deal with the problem of the casting flash, and then put helicoils in the bolt holes... and you can get the procomps with the special offset rocker arms and valvesprings for about the same money as a set of bare victor heads without the rockers or the springs that's already saving about 500 bucks, cnc ported versions just a tad bit more, so you can probably get a set of cnc ported heads that will outflow the stock victors with rocker arms and springs for about the same amount of money if not less than the victors without cnc ported by time you buy the rockers and springs, and have spare cash to go elsewhere..
